Legal News and Analysis - Malaysia - Banking & Finance, Dispute Resolution, Regulatory & Compliance - Web21 apr. 2024 · The lender may also be prosecuted for an offence under Section 5 of the Moneylenders Act 1951. Those found to be in violation of the Act they will be fined for not less than RM250,000 but not more than RM1,000,000, or imprisonment for no more than 5 years, or both.
